Jessica Fisch (aka Jessi) is an avant-garde artist, alto/contralto vocalist, and producer based in Philadelphia, PA. Her signature art-rock style cross-pollinates a blend of rock, R&B, jazz, grunge, and electronic elements, all wrapped in opulent orchestral arrangements and a distinct theatrical twist. She is currently in the mixing stages of her concept EP, expected later this year.

As a feel-based contemporary keyboardist, Jessica is deeply inspired by classic rock, blues, and 90s alternative music. This rich musical foundation allows her to put a soulful, heart-wrenching spin on vintage classics while crafting bold new sonic landscapes.

On stage, her performances balance bold dynamism with quiet mystery, engaging her audience and creating a genuine connection. As an emcee, she feels energized by connecting through spoken word, and uses her stage presence, sharp improvisational skills, and comedic flair to deliver an exuberant and entertaining show.
